He was very, very good in 2016, in fact bar Kelly was our best back that year. 21 games, averaging over 17 disposals and 6 marks a game and was one of our most reliable fill-ins. He then didn’t get a look in whatsoever when the gang returned in 2017 and that was pretty much it from there on, only getting a game as depth to the depth. Think he deserved more games as he was at times a quality rebounder and good mark for his size. All the best and thanks for filling in in our darkest times.
